public class ReactiveStringRedisTemplate extends ReactiveRedisTemplate<String,String>
String-focused
extension of ReactiveRedisTemplate
. As most operations against Redis
are String
based, this class provides a dedicated arrangement that minimizes configuration of its more
generic template
especially in terms of the used RedisSerializationContext
.Constructor and Description |
---|
ReactiveStringRedisTemplate(ReactiveRedisConnectionFactory connectionFactory)
Creates new
ReactiveRedisTemplate using given ReactiveRedisConnectionFactory applying default
String serialization. |
ReactiveStringRedisTemplate(ReactiveRedisConnectionFactory connectionFactory,
RedisSerializationContext<String,String> serializationContext)
Creates new
ReactiveRedisTemplate using given ReactiveRedisConnectionFactory and
RedisSerializationContext . |
ReactiveStringRedisTemplate(ReactiveRedisConnectionFactory connectionFactory,
RedisSerializationContext<String,String> serializationContext,
boolean exposeConnection)
Creates new
ReactiveRedisTemplate using given ReactiveRedisConnectionFactory and
RedisSerializationContext . |
convertAndSend, createFlux, createMono, createRedisConnectionProxy, delete, delete, execute, execute, execute, execute, expire, expireAt, getConnectionFactory, getExpire, getSerializationContext, hasKey, keys, listenTo, move, opsForGeo, opsForGeo, opsForHash, opsForHash, opsForHyperLogLog, opsForHyperLogLog, opsForList, opsForList, opsForSet, opsForSet, opsForStream, opsForStream, opsForStream, opsForStream, opsForValue, opsForValue, opsForZSet, opsForZSet, persist, postProcessResult, preProcessConnection, randomKey, rename, renameIfAbsent, scan, type, unlink, unlink
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
execute, execute, listenToChannel, listenToPattern, scan
public ReactiveStringRedisTemplate(ReactiveRedisConnectionFactory connectionFactory)
ReactiveRedisTemplate
using given ReactiveRedisConnectionFactory
applying default
String
serialization.connectionFactory
- must not be null.RedisSerializationContext.string()
public ReactiveStringRedisTemplate(ReactiveRedisConnectionFactory connectionFactory, RedisSerializationContext<String,String> serializationContext)
ReactiveRedisTemplate
using given ReactiveRedisConnectionFactory
and
RedisSerializationContext
.connectionFactory
- must not be null.serializationContext
- must not be null.public ReactiveStringRedisTemplate(ReactiveRedisConnectionFactory connectionFactory, RedisSerializationContext<String,String> serializationContext, boolean exposeConnection)
ReactiveRedisTemplate
using given ReactiveRedisConnectionFactory
and
RedisSerializationContext
.connectionFactory
- must not be null.serializationContext
- must not be null.exposeConnection
- flag indicating to expose the connection used.Copyright © 2011–2021 Pivotal Software, Inc.. All rights reserved.